devStuff:CSS、JavaScript、TypeScript与GitHub开发实践

需积分: 5 0 下载量 176 浏览量 更新于2025-03-27 收藏 1KB ZIP 举报
标题“devStuff”所指的似乎是一个包含开发相关资源和工具的集合或者项目名称。根据描述部分,我们可以提取以下关键知识点: 1. CSS(层叠样式表):CSS是一种用于描述网页呈现样式的计算机语言,它使得网页设计者能够通过使用诸如文字大小、字体、颜色、布局、以及其他视觉格式化选项等来控制网页的外观和格式。CSS 与 HTML(超文本标记语言)和JavaScript 一起构成构成网页开发的三大核心技术。 2. JavaScript:JavaScript 是一种高级的、解释型的编程语言,主要用于网页上实现动态和交互式内容。它是所有现代网页浏览器所支持的脚本语言,可用来改变HTML和CSS,从而创建丰富的用户界面和体验。JavaScript 也可以在服务器端使用,比如Node.js。 3. 打字稿(TypeScript):TypeScript 是 JavaScript 的一个超集,通过添加静态类型定义和其他特性,增强了JavaScript的能力。TypeScript 最终会被编译成纯JavaScript,使其能在任何浏览器、Node.js环境或者其他支持JavaScript的平台上运行。打字稿有助于提前发现代码中的错误,并使大型代码库更容易维护。 4. 哈克兰克(Haskell):虽然哈克兰克不是一个在描述中直接提到的术语,但这里我们可以推测它可能是指Haskell编程语言。Haskell 是一种纯函数式编程语言,它拥有强大的类型系统和高度的抽象性,常用于研究和教育目的,但也可用于构建可扩展、安全的软件系统。 5. 设计:设计在这里可能指的是与开发工作紧密相连的界面设计和用户体验设计。它不仅仅关系到一个产品的视觉外观,还包括如何与用户互动,以及如何根据用户的需求和行为来优化产品。一个成功的软件或应用背后往往有着精心的设计过程。 6. GitHub:GitHub是一个基于Git的代码托管平台,允许开发者进行代码版本控制、协作和项目管理。GitHub 提供了分布式版本控制和源代码管理功能,它是开源项目的主要托管地,同时也是开发者交流、代码共享和团队协作的重要工具。 结合这些知识点,我们可以得知,这个名为“devStuff”的集合或项目可能包含了一系列的开发工具和资源,包括但不限于CSS样式指南、JavaScript脚本示例、TypeScript项目样例、可能的Haskell项目以及关于设计的资源。GitHub表明这些资源可能在版本控制系统中被组织,并且可以供多人协作使用。 由于标签信息为空,我们不能确定“devStuff”具体的应用场景或者目标受众,不过从文件名称列表“devStuff-main”可以推断,可能存在着一个或多个包含主要资源或入口的子目录或仓库。因此,“devStuff”很可能是一个综合性的开发资源集合,支持多种开发技术和设计方法论,让开发者能够更高效地创建、管理和维护他们的项目。
2025-04-01 上传